Understanding Windshield Washer Fluid Residue

Windshield washer fluid residue is often caused by the buildup of detergents, dyes, and other additives in the fluid. When the fluid dries up, it can leave streaks or spots that not only look unappealing but can also impair your vision while driving. Understanding the causes and effects of this residue is the first step in effectively cleaning it.

Common Causes of Windshield Washer Fluid Residue

  • Low-Quality Washer Fluids: Using cheap or low-quality washer fluids can lead to excessive residue buildup.
  • Environmental Factors: Dust, pollen, and other environmental pollutants can mix with the washer fluid, exacerbating the residue problem.
  • Improper Usage: Overusing washer fluid or using it inappropriately can lead to more residue.

Tools and Materials Needed

Before you start cleaning the residue, gather the necessary tools and materials.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Microfiber cloths
  • Glass cleaner (preferably ammonia-free)
  • Warm water
  • Bucket
  • Soft-bristle brush (optional)
  • Rubber gloves (optional)

Step-by-Step Guide to Clean Windshield Washer Fluid Residue

Step 1: Prepare Your Cleaning Solution

Start by preparing a cleaning solution. You can use a commercial glass cleaner or make your own by mixing equal parts of warm water and vinegar. The acidity of vinegar helps break down residue effectively.

Step 2: Apply the Cleaning Solution

Using a microfiber cloth, apply the cleaning solution directly to the affected areas. Be sure to saturate the cloth, as this will help lift the residue more effectively.

Step 3: Wipe Down the Windshield

Gently wipe the windshield in a circular motion, applying light pressure. If the residue is stubborn, let the cleaning solution sit for a minute before wiping. This allows the solution to penetrate the residue more effectively.

Step 4: Scrub Stubborn Areas

If there are particularly stubborn spots, use a soft-bristle brush to gently scrub those areas. Be careful not to scratch the glass, as this can create further visibility issues.

Step 5: Rinse the Windshield

After cleaning, it’s essential to rinse the windshield with clean water. This will help remove any leftover cleaning solution and residue. Use a clean microfiber cloth to dry the windshield thoroughly.

Step 6: Clean the Wipers

Don’t forget about your windshield wipers! Residue can build up on the blades, affecting their performance. Dampen a microfiber cloth with your cleaning solution and wipe down the wiper blades. This will help remove any residue and ensure that they perform optimally.

Step 7: Final Inspection

Once everything is dry, do a final check to ensure that all residue has been removed. If you spot any remaining residue, repeat the cleaning process as necessary.

Preventing Future Residue Buildup

Cleaning windshield washer fluid residue is essential, but prevention is key to keeping your windshield clear in the long run. Here are some tips to prevent future buildup:

  • Choose High-Quality Washer Fluid: Invest in a quality washer fluid that is designed to minimize residue.
  • Regular Maintenance: Clean your windshield regularly to prevent residue from accumulating.
  • Store Properly: Store your washer fluid in a cool, dark place to prevent degradation of the fluid.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

How often should I clean my windshield?

It’s recommended to clean your windshield regularly, especially if you notice residue buildup. A good rule of thumb is to clean it at least once a month or whenever you refill your washer fluid.

Can I use household cleaners to clean my windshield?

While some household cleaners can work, it’s best to use products specifically designed for automotive glass to avoid streaking or damage.

What should I do if my wipers are leaving streaks?

If your wipers are leaving streaks, it may be time to clean the blades or replace them if they are worn. Cleaning the blades with a suitable solution can often resolve the issue.

Is it safe to use vinegar on my windshield?

Yes, vinegar is safe to use on your windshield when diluted with water. However, avoid using it in extreme temperatures, as it may not be effective.

How can I prevent streaks when cleaning my windshield?

To prevent streaks, use a high-quality microfiber cloth and a suitable glass cleaner. Clean the windshield in a circular motion and avoid cleaning in direct sunlight.
